Experimental Properties
- Color/Form: colorless liquid
- Density: 0.984
- Boiling Point: 123°C/30mmHg(lit.)
- Flash Point: 75 °C
- Refractive Index: 1.43-1.432
- PSA: 26.30000
- LogP: 3.72230
- Solubility: Insoluble in water
- Vapor Pressure: 0.2±0.4 mmHg at 25°C

Introduction to N-Octyl Chloroformate (CAS No. 7452-59-7) in Modern Chemical Research
N-Octyl Chloroformate, with the chemical formula C?H??ClO? and CAS number 7452-59-7, is a significant compound in the field of organic synthesis and pharmaceutical development. This octyl ester of chloroformic acid has garnered considerable attention due to its versatile applications in chemical modifications, particularly in the synthesis of active pharmaceutical ingredients (APIs) and specialty chemicals. The compound’s unique structural properties, characterized by a long hydrocarbon chain and a reactive chloroformate group, make it an invaluable reagent in various synthetic pathways.
The CAS No. 7452-59-7 identifier is a crucial reference point for researchers and industrial chemists, ensuring precise identification and handling of this chemical. N-Octyl Chloroformate is primarily utilized as an acylating agent, facilitating the introduction of ester functionalities into molecules. This capability is particularly relevant in drug discovery, where ester-linked compounds often exhibit enhanced bioavailability and metabolic stability. Recent advancements in medicinal chemistry have highlighted the role of such derivatives in developing novel therapeutic agents.
In the realm of pharmaceutical research, N-Octyl Chloroformate has been explored for its potential in modifying peptide and protein-based drugs. The long alkyl chain of the octyl group provides favorable solubility characteristics, making it suitable for formulation studies aimed at improving drug delivery systems. For instance, researchers have investigated its use in creating prodrugs that release active pharmaceutical ingredients under specific physiological conditions. Such innovations align with the growing demand for targeted therapies that enhance efficacy while minimizing side effects.
Moreover, the reactivity of the chloroformate moiety in N-Octyl Chloroformate allows for efficient coupling reactions with nucleophiles, including amines and alcohols. This property has been leveraged in the synthesis of complex molecules, such as conjugates used in immunotherapy. Recent studies have demonstrated its utility in generating antibody-drug conjugates (ADCs), where precise chemical linkers are essential for ensuring controlled drug release at tumor sites. The stability and reactivity profile of CAS No 7452-59-7 make it a preferred choice for such high-value applications.
Industrial applications of N-Octyl Chloroformate extend beyond pharmaceuticals into agrochemicals and polymer science. In agrochemical research, derivatives of this compound have been examined for their role as intermediates in synthesizing herbicides and fungicides. The octyl group’s hydrophobic nature enhances the lipophilicity of these derivatives, improving their absorption and translocation within plant tissues. Similarly, in polymer chemistry, N-Octyl Chloroformate has been employed to modify polymeric materials, imparting specific functional properties that are critical for advanced material applications.
